Research Backgrounds

Function:

Myozenins may serve as intracellular binding proteins involved in linking Z line proteins such as alpha-actinin, gamma-filamin, TCAP/telethonin, LDB3/ZASP and localizing calcineurin signaling to the sarcomere. Plays an important role in the modulation of calcineurin signaling. May play a role in myofibrillogenesis.

Subcellular Location:

Cytoplasm>Myofibril>Sarcomere>Z line.
Note: Colocalizes with ACTN1 and PPP3CA at the Z-line of heart and skeletal muscle.

Tissue Specificity:

Expressed specifically in heart and skeletal muscle.

Subunit Structure:

Interacts via its C-terminus with spectrin repeats 3 and 4 of ACTN2. Interacts with ACTN1, LDB3, MYOT and PPP3CA.

Family&Domains:

Belongs to the myozenin family.
